What the work is worth. Whether a community learns its water is contaminated — and whether it gets fixed — is often an environmental scientist's report. This is science as public protection.
An ordinary day. Collect samples in the field, analyze soil, water, and air, assess environmental risk, write reports, and advise agencies and companies on compliance and cleanup.
The path in. Bachelor's in environmental science or a natural science; master's for advancement.
